    Default Getting OFF Edge

    Due to the recent maildir fun I find myself running edge on a few boxes.
    Normally I run release and would like to get back to that.

    I'm running 10.8.0-E63 and I'd like to get back to the release tree and of
    course I'd like the release build to be newer than the edge that I'm currently running.

    The changelog seems out of date and I've never been able to get my head around
    the system cpanel uses for this.

    If I see an R64 is that newer than an E63?

    E67 -> C68 -> and probably R69... that's how it works.

    That's completely wrong See my explaination here:
    http://forums.cpanel.net/showpost.ph...0&postcount=11

    If the RELEASE tree version is higher that your EDGE version then you can switch to RELEASE.
